## Deployment

The Grainsheet export worker buffers entire workbooks in memory before streaming them out, so large exports can push a pod past its memory limit. Scale the worker pool rather than raising per-pod limits; OOM restarts mid-export corrupt the output. Monitor the export queue depth after each deploy. The deployment-relevant configuration values are listed below.

settings of tajep-tafog:
CASDOR_LOG_LEVEL=info
CASDOR_METRICS_HOST=metrics.casdor.nelvrosys.internal
CASDOR_POOL_SIZE=16

**CI note: timezone weirdness in report exports**

Heads up, support folks — if a customer says their Ledgerpine export shows times shifted by a few hours, it's probably the CI image. The export workers got rebuilt last week and the base image defaults to UTC, while older workers used the account's locale. Fix is rolling out; meanwhile tell customers the data itself is fine, just the display offset. Affected exports carry the build token shown below.

build token for bajof-tahop: htk4_a981

**The Recording Studio — quick notes for reception**

Our little training-video studio sits behind the Level 3 meeting pods at Oakhaven Place. If someone from the Learning team asks you to let a presenter in, check the booking sheet first — the red light above the door means a session is live, so hold visitors until it's off. To unlock the studio door, use the code below.

door code, kawip-bagap: bdg-HQEWH-4

## 2.4.0 — Setting renamed

squishcli: `RESIZE_KEY` is now `SQUISH_API_TOKEN`. Old name removed, no fallback. Batch resize jobs fail at startup if the old name is present. Release manager: regenerate env files for all runner pools before tagging. Each regenerated file must declare the new token on the line directly below this note.

vault entry, yahaf-tagug: LEDGER_TOKEN20=884d77d1a8b98aa4edfb